Design and analysis of microstrip antenna array in E & H plane for high gain applications
Linear patch arrays can be very useful where space is the matter of concern in one direction. Like planar array, linear arrays are also capable of providing high gain and directivity with beam scanning. The paper focuses on air borne applications. Proposed linear array are suitable due to its conformability and meeting the constraint of space for such applications. The design presented in this paper proposes to increase the gain and as well as bandwidth by keeping acceptable values of VSWR and return loss.
